Pandas

Boring Animals

The giant panda is one of nature’s most beloved creatures because of its beautiful appearance. However, it is one of the most boring animals because it spends most of its time eating and sleeping.

Pandas are a species of animal that eat bamboo; hence, in order to obtain enough nutrients for the day, a panda will need to consume up to 20 kg (44 lb.) of bamboo.

Can you guess how long it will take the panda to eat? Well, all that chewing is pretty tiring, and so often the panda sleeps for about three hours and then gets up to eat some more before taking another three-hour siesta.

How’s that for a boring animal?

Koalas

Boring Animals

Well, if you think a panda is a boring animal, you haven’t met a koala. Talk about a boring animal lifestyle! This animal has a 20-hour sleep capacity!

So, what does an animal do when it’s only awake for 2 hours? Apparently, prioritizing survival is everything!

So as long as the koala is awake, it will feed. Eucalyptus is the main part of koalas. This plant is high in fiber and contains toxins, so between the slow breakdown of the fiber and the processing of the toxins, the koala’s body expends a lot of energy in digestion.

No wonder they sleep so late!

Hippos

Boring Animals

Hippopotamuses are boring animals. First, they’re a bunch of heavy sleepers, piling on top of each other and going 16 to 20 hours on any given day.

They are awake for a few hours, about 5 hours, grazing both on land and in water.

Boring as they are, here’s an interesting tidbit. They can sleep both on land and in water, only coming up every so often to breathe air. They are so lazy that they eat and sleep wherever they are, whether on land or in water.
